What Does a Residential Property Locksmith Do?

Residential property locksmith professionals specialize in a range of services created to boost home security and address lock-related issues. Their competence includes:

ServiceDescriptionLock InstallationInstalling brand-new locks on doors, windows, and gates.Lock RepairFixing harmed or malfunctioning locks.Key DuplicationDeveloping extra secrets for property owners.Emergency Lockout ServicesHelping individuals locked out of their homes.Lock RekeyingChanging the internal system of a lock so old keys no longer work.Security AssessmentsEvaluating a home's security and advising improvements.Smart Lock InstallationInstalling electronic locks that can be managed through smartphone or other devices.Deadbolt InstallationIncluding an extra layer of security with deadbolts.Safe Installation and UnlockingSetting up safes and assisting in the occasion of forgotten combinations.

Frequently asked question Section

What should I do if I'm locked out of my home?

If you find yourself locked out, the initial step is to remain calm. Look into reliable local locksmiths who provide 24/7 emergency services. Avoid trying to unlock the door yourself, as this might harm the lock or door.

How can I boost my home's security?

Consider upgrading locks to clever locks, setting up deadbolts, establishing surveillance systems, and incorporating motion-activated lights around the property. A professional locksmith can offer a security evaluation for more tailored solutions.

How often should I rekey my locks?

Rekey your locks whenever you move into a brand-new home, after losing a key, or if you believe someone may have unapproved gain access to. It's likewise smart to reevaluate your security system periodically.

Are clever locks worth the financial investment?

Yes, wise locks often feature advanced features such as remote gain access to, temporary codes, and automated locking, which adds convenience and improved security compared to traditional locks.

Do locksmiths offer an emergency service?

Most professional locksmith professionals provide 24/7 emergency services, permitting quick assistance during lockouts. Always verify the locksmith's availability before an emergency develops.
